110-120V LVC-IV—Low Voltage Control Module By Draper
USES: 1. The 110-120V LVC-IV is used to control one 110-120 volt motor in a variety of ways:
a. Low voltage wall switch
b. “Dry” contact closure
c. RF (Radio Frequency) remote control (range: 250 feet open distance).
d. IR (Infrared) remote control (range 26 feet).
e. Serial Communication or low voltage relay (3v-28v).
These options isolate the user from a potential electrical shock.
2. The 110-120V LVC-IV can also be used as a Single-Pole, Double-Throw dry closure
to control other equipment by the same means listed in #1 above.
COMPATIBILITY: LVC-S low voltage wall switch.
WRT/R radio frequency remote control package (connects to “Eye” port).
IRT/R infrared remote control package (connects to “Eye” port).
SP-KSM 3-position momentary key switch (beware: Stop won’t work).
Auxiliary control systems employing “dry” contacts.
KS-1 Power Supply Key Switch.
CONTACTS: Emulates Single-Pole, Double-Throw. Maintained for approx. 3 minutes.
RATING: Input: 110-120 VAC +/- 10%, 50/60 Hz
Output: 110-120 VAC, 3.15 Amps, 50/60 Hz. Fused with 250 VAC, 3.15 Amps
UL and c-UL recognized.
DESCRIPTION: The module contains a 3-screw terminal block for a low voltage wall switch,
an IR receiver jack, a built-in RF receiver, two-RJ25 ports for RS232/RS485,
a low voltage relay port with cable and a user-serviceable 3.5 A fuse.
PART NUMBER: 121222
